Common Commercial Pavement Repair Jobs
Pothole Repairs - filling and sealing potholes to restore a smooth driving surface.
Crack Filling - sealing cracks to prevent water intrusion and pavement deterioration.
Surface Patching - repairing damaged areas to extend the lifespan of the pavement.
Joint and Seam Repairs - fixing expansion joints and seams to maintain pavement integrity.
Overlay and Resurfacing - applying a new surface layer to improve pavement appearance and durability.
Drainage Repairs - addressing drainage issues to prevent water damage and pooling.
Commercial Pavement Repair Questions
What types of pavement repair services are available for commercial properties? Services include crack filling, pothole patching, surface leveling, and overlay installation to restore pavement durability and appearance.
How can I tell if my commercial pavement need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, potholes, uneven surfaces, and water pooling, which indicate deterioration requiring attention.
What are common causes of pavement damage in commercial areas? Damage often results from heavy vehicle traffic, weather exposure, and ground movement over time.
What should property owners consider before scheduling pavement repair? It is important to assess the extent of damage, plan for minimal disruption, and choose appropriate repair methods for longevity.
